Class Discussion:
Pose a mixed reasoning problem on the board:
“Anna eats 0.3 of a pizza and Ben eats 1/4 of the same pizza. Who eats more? How do you know?”
Invite selected pupils to explain step-by-step how they would solve it.
Reflect on learning: Which part did you find easiest or trickiest today and why? How did you check your answers?
Use a quick quiz on mini whiteboards – flash 3 questions with fractions and decimals mix requiring explanation, e.g., “Explain why 0.2 and 1/5 are the same or different.”
